Travis Scott – Birds In The Trap Sing McKnight

Travis Scott – Birds In The Trap Sing McKnight (Grand Hustle Records, 2016)

Birds In The Trap Sing McKnight is Houston rapper Travis Scott’s second full-length studio album, and an incredible follow-up to his 2015 album Rodeo. On this new LP, Scott teams up with famed producer Mike Dean to create some of the best and catchiest songs trap rap has to offer. Each beat is moody and layered—creating a vibe that could be perfectly suited for a party or a late-night drive. The tracklist progresses like a story, allowing Scott to open up and get personal with the listener. One shortcoming of the record, however, is that many of the songs blend together and start to sound the same. This, mixed with a lack of lyrical substance, keeps this album from reaching its full potential. Despite these slight hiccups, Scott’s latest LP is a masterclass in rap instrumentals and one of his best projects to date.

Trial Song: Pick Up The Phone (ft. Young Thug and Quavo)

Score: 8.5/10

PartyNextDoor – PartyNextDoor 3

PartyNextDoor – PartyNextDoor 3 (OVO Sounds/Warner Bros, 2016)

PartyNextDoor 3 combines mellow trap music with a dance hall, reggae vibe. If you like The Weeknd, Drake or Tory Lanez, you’ll like this album. His song “Not Nice” will get stuck in your head after just the first listen. It’s a soft dancehall jam that will instantly make you slow whine to the rhythm—an excellent choice for a house party. “Only You” is a romantic reggae tune that is very easy to like. Then he jumps into deeper trap music with a heavy bass lines with “Don’t Know How” and “Problems & Selfless.” Party Next Door’s trap music has soft, slow rhythms—mixed with his dreamy voice, it’s the type of music you’ll listen to when you just want to chill out or when you’re late night driving after a long work shift. His hit from the album is “Come and See Me” featuring Drake. It has a flowy R&B feel, tells a story, and will surely get stuck in your head for weeks. His songs are guaranteed to relax you.

Trial Track: “Come and See Me”

7.5/10
